I have a div (it’s a popup for an openlayers map, but it could pretty much be any fixed size div), that contains a jquery ui menu (which is wrapped in a ul). The menu doesn’t fit inside the div very well, so I’d like to make the menu float above it so that as the menu grows I don’t have to grow the size of the containing div. Is this possible?

The containing div is itself positioned absolutely, I’ve tried setting the ul that represents the menu to position:absolute;z-index:100 but that doesn’t work. I’ve also tried setting overflow:visible with no joy.

    If you tell me that my answer is not what you mean I will delete it cause I am not sure what you really need to do. You want this scrolls to disappear and if the text is bigger than the popup just to float over no matter it is going outline ?

    If this is what you want you have to remove the overflow: auto from .olFramedCloudPopupContent and again to remove overflow: auto from inline style of the element #chicken_contentDiv (I am not sure that you add it with jQuery).
